By Sophie Boot Sept. 1 (BusinessDesk) - New Zealand shares rose as offshore investors looking for yield were lured to the local bourse. Fisher & Paykel Healthcare and Auckland International Airport led the index higher while Steel & Tube Holdings fell. The S&P/NZX 50 Index rose 24.36 points, or 0.3 percent, to 7,423.19. Within the index, 24 stocks fell, 22 rose and five were unchanged. Turnover was $170.7 million.
